DURATION AND DIFFICULTY OF HIKE: Gently paced with opportunities to stop and talk about interesting things along the trail and work with camera's, dress to be standing still more than hiking.

What to wear: Dress for the weather (current and future) and dress in layers! Many people like to wear long pants/sleeves to protect themselves from the sun, dirt, and things that might make you itchy (mosquitos, etc.). Avoid cotton when you’re able to and go with a synthetic material or wool. Also remember to wear sturdy hiking shoes, good socks, a cool sun hat, and sunscreen!

What to bring in your day pack: 2 Water bottles, snacks, sunscreen, extra layers (long sleeve shirt, fleece) and also bring your waterproof jacket- weather changes quickly, make sure to come for cooler/wet weather

  • Must bring your own camera, tripod recommended but not necessary.  Geared toward DSLR; any camera welcome!
  • Something to kneel on might be nice (such as a small tarp, foam matt, garden kneelers).
